Antique print from 1832 of the Four Court’s Dublin. The print was engraved by Owen and is after a drawing by William Bartlett.

The print was published by Fisher and Sons in London in 1832.

The engraving is 4 by 6 inches with the overall paper size being 5 1/2 by 8 inches

The engraving is in very good overall condition for age, paper will show ageing, foxing on print and paper, please see pictures.
